Marcos Snyder
The Founder and Director of Dairylando, an agronomist engineer with more than 35 years of experience in the dairy industry, is a well-known reference in the analysis, and the economics of the dairy farms in Argentina.
Throughout his career, he has held key positions, such as advisory of CREA groups for 24 years, Director of the Provincial Dairy Program of Buenos Aires, and Institutional Coordinator of AACREA. In addition, he has been manager of APYMEL and participated in the Executive Committee of the AAPA and the Strategic Plan of Dairy (PEL).
Today, Marcos combines his leadership in dairy companies with his work as a consultant, speaker, and columnist specializing on dairy issues.
